June 25, 2025
Brooklyn, New York, USA
Q. Talk about your night. How does it feel for the moment to be here after the journey you've taken?
WALTER CLAYTON JR.: For sure, it feels great. This is something I've worked toward my whole life. My family sacrificed a lot for me to be here, so I'm just thankful. It's a great feeling.
Q. Coming into Utah, big draft year for them, multiple picks in the first round. How do you see yourself fitting in with Ace and the rest of the team?
WALTER CLAYTON JR.: For sure, I feel great. I think throughout my college years I played with multiple great players and we found a way to mesh well and win games, so I don't see anything different in Utah. We're going to plan to do that.
Q. You went from living in beautiful, sunny Florida. Now you're going to be in snowy, cold Utah. What's that adjustment going to be like?
WALTER CLAYTON JR.: I was in New York my first two years of college. I heard New York might be a little worse than Utah. So I think I'll be good.
Q. Could you just look back on your journey from being a high school football player to going to a place like Iona you really didn't know anything about to where you are now? Is it hard to believe?
WALTER CLAYTON JR.: I wouldn't say hard to believe. I try not to look into the future too much. I try to take everything day by day. I'm just worrying about the next day, getting the job done, whatever day that is.
Q. What does it mean to you to be a top-20 NBA Draft pick?
WALTER CLAYTON JR.: It means there's a lot more work to do. I think there's a front office that believes in me and they expect me to come in and do my job.
Q. The whole age thing, I think you were the first guy taken who spent more than one year in college. What does that say about you, and what does that mean to you?
WALTER CLAYTON JR.: For sure. It means a lot. Like I said, it's a front office that's trusted in me, trusted in my skill set. Nothing is going to change. I'm going to continue to work every summer and improve my game every year.
